The Propranolol … WebOct 4, 2024 · Yes, propranolol might be prescribed “off-label” by your doctor to treat some types of anxiety. "Off-label" use of a drug is when a doctor prescribes it for a different purpose than those formally approved by the FDA. Propranolol can help with symptoms of social anxiety like fast heart rate, sweating and shaking in certain circumstances. WebPharmacotherapy for Post-traumatic Stress Disorder In Combat Veterans: Focus on Antidepressants and Atypical Antipsychotic Agents WebThere was moderate quality evidence that hydrocortisone reduced the severity of PTSD symptoms. There was no evidence that propranolol (a beta-blocker), escitalopram (a type of antidepressant), temazepam (a tranquillizer) or gabapentin (an anticonvulsant) prevented PTSD. All medications were acceptable, with low numbers of people dropping out ...

WebMay 10, 2024 · Propranolol — Propranolol has been tested in the immediate aftermath of trauma exposure, with the hypothesis that reducing noradrenergic activation would result in reduced conditioning of the trauma memories and prevent the development of PTSD. WebSep 24, 2003 · This 10-week study will examine whether propranolol, a medication that blocks the activity of the stress hormones adrenaline and noradrenaline, can relieve acute stress disorder (ASD) and symptoms from persisting long-term. ASD is a condition that some people develop soon after exposure to trauma.
